Lines Matching refs:avail_idx
385 return ACCESS_ONCE(vr->info->avail_idx); in read_avail_idx()
524 __u16 avail_idx = read_avail_idx(vr); in spin_for_descriptors() local
526 while (avail_idx == le16toh(ACCESS_ONCE(vr->vr.avail->idx))) { in spin_for_descriptors()
530 le16toh(vr->vr.avail->idx), vr->info->avail_idx); in spin_for_descriptors()
667 while (rx_vr.info->avail_idx != in virtio_net()
866 while (rx_vr.info->avail_idx != in virtio_console()
1175 __u16 avail_idx; in virtio_block() local
1226 while (vring.info->avail_idx != in virtio_block()
1229 avail_idx = in virtio_block()
1230 vring.info->avail_idx & in virtio_block()
1233 vring.vr.avail->ring[avail_idx]); in virtio_block()
1238 vring.info->avail_idx); in virtio_block()